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64 56825974 7673920371 23 34
97321711 54 25
97321711 54 25
99483056 9275159 2127120 162229013
All about undefined
Interested in learning more?
97321711 54 25
99483056 9275159 2127120 162229013
See more
4703 1903
53 55 20 1756807
See more
75004907 75494511 36
99648 05781526877 90892
See more